# Template Management
## Commands
### TEMPLATE
Manages documentation templates
#### Arguments:
- `operation` (string, required): Template operation to perform. Options: "create", "update", "delete", "list", "sync"
- `template_type` (string, required): Type of template. Options: "product", "technical", "process", "simplified"
- `template_name` (string): Name of the template
## Template System
The template system provides structured documentation patterns for different project types and phases.
### Base Paths
- Product templates: `.cursor/rules/templates/Product`
- Simplified templates: `.cursor/rules/templates/simplified_templates`
- Generated templates: `.cursor/rules/templates/generated`

## Git Workflow Templates
- **GitHub Flow**: Simple branch-based workflow
- **GitFlow**: Structured workflow with develop and release branches
- **Trunk-Based**: Development directly on main with feature flags
- **No Workflow**: Basic Git usage without formal methodology
